Badulla is a city and human settlement located in Sri Lanka. It serves as the capital of both Badulla District and Uva Province. The city is situated at an elevation of 680 meters above sea level and covers an area of 10 square kilometers. Its official name is also recorded in Sinhala and Tamil scripts.
The population of Badulla is listed as 43,000 in one source, while another records it as 47,587. The local dialing code is 55, and the area operates in the UTC+05:30 time zone. Badulla is described in the 11th edition of the Encyclopædia Britannica.

Badulla (, ; ,) is the capital and the largest city of Uva Province situated in the central hills of Sri Lanka. It is the capital city of Uva Province and the Badulla District.
==Geography== Badulu Oya|thumb|left Badulla is located in the southeast of Kandy, almost encircled by the Badulu Oya River, about above sea level and is surrounded by tea plantations. The city is overshadowed by the Namunukula range of mountains (highest peak above sea level). It was a base of a pre-colonial Sinhalese local prince (regional king) who ruled the area under the main King in Kandy before it became part of the British Empire. Later, it became one of the provincial administrative hubs of the British rulers. The city was the terminus of upcountry railway line built by the British in order to take mainly tea plantation products to Colombo.
